Creating a form from scratch

If you don’t have any existing forms in your system, or if you want to create a form with questions that don’t exist in your other forms, create your form from scratch.

To create a form from scratch:

  1. Do one of the following: · Navigate to the Apply Online portlet and click Admin this portlet. · Navigate to the Make an Inquiry portlet and click Admin this portlet. The system displays the Admin screen for the portlet that you chose.

  2. Do one of the following: · If you working in the Apply Online portlet, click Add A New Application. · If you’re working in the Make an Inquiry portlet, click Add a new form.

  3. The system displays the Form Builder: New Form screen.

  4. In the Form Name field, enter a name for the form.

  5. Click Add New Content.

  6. The system displays the Form Builder: Your Form Name/Add a Section screen.

  7. In the Section Name field, enter a name for the first section of your form. Each form must have at least one section. A section is essentially a page within the form.

  8. If you want this section to include an image, enter an path in the Image File field.

  9. If you want to include instructions, enter text in the Text field.

  10. If appropriate, use the Image Placement field to specify whether you want the instructions to be displayed to the left of the instructions or below them.

  11. Click Save. The system displays the Form Builder: Your Form Name screen, which lets you add questions and make other modifications to your form.

  12. Add as many questions as are necessary, as described in “Adding questions” on page 3.

  13. If appropriate, add additional sections (pages) to your form

  14. Click Save.
